Maguga Dam Viewpoint
Visit Maguga Dam Viewpoint
Popular places to visit
Traditional Swazi Craft Markets
You can browse for the perfect souvenirs at Traditional Swazi Craft Markets during your visit to Mbabane. Discover the mountain views in this relaxing area.
Ezulwini Valley
Commune with nature and explore the great outdoors at Ezulwini Valley during your travels in Lobamba. Discover the area's mountain views and shops.
Maguga Dam
Explore the great outdoors at Maguga Dam, a lovely green space in Piggs Peak. While you're in the area, wander around the natural setting.
The Mdzimba Trail
You can take time to visit The Mdzimba Trail during your travels to Mbabane. Discover the mountain views in this relaxing area.
The Lobamba Trail
You can take time to visit The Lobamba Trail during your travels to Mbabane. Discover the mountain views in this relaxing area.
Swaziland Theater Club
You can get tickets for a performance at Swaziland Theater Club during your stay in Mbabane. Discover the mountain views in this relaxing area.